ZFR: EDIT: Also, after a bit of analysis with a magnifying glass, it seems that it's not a pure interpolation algorithm, but it also takes into account the physical position of the 3 colour subpixels.
Yes, I left out the whole subpixel thing from my explanation, as that makes things considerably more complicated. It's still a major factor though, and in some cases it makes for some really odd results. For instance, with the barcodes I was talking about before, they were pure black on a pure white background. As such, you would expect any interpolation artifacts to be some shade of grey (R=G=B), but that was not the case. Some lines would have red or blue shadows at the edges, due to subpixel positioning.
